Just a quick video showing how I replaced front brake pads & rotors on a 2011 Honda Civic.
Tools Needed:
Large flathead screwdriver or small pry bar
12mm socket and/or wrench
19mm open end wrench (for the square end of the slide pins)
Torque specs I found online: 25 ft. lbs for the front caliper slide pin bolts. (I recommend checking that in your manual to make sure that's correct.)

I'm not changing my own brake pads, but just going to watch over my husband doing this. I didn't see you using a C-clamp to release the calipers or did I miss this? I also didn't see you bleed the brakes. Some info in other places say, you must bleed the brakes. Is it true to not get any grease, or lube on the brake pad side that will be touching the rotor to stop the car?
@brightwebltd2864
@brightwebltd2864 5 месяцев назад
He didn’t use the C-clamp style press because at the start he said that he prefers to use a screw driver, but I would discourage this as you can scratch your rotor with the screwdriver (that’s not good). You don’t need to bleed your brakes, but it’s better to as the fluid is hydroscopic (absorbs water) and degrades overtime (e.g. hard braking). DO NOT GET GREASE OR OIL ON THE ROTOR OR FRICTION MATERIAL (Brake pad surface) as this will greatly diminish your cars braking ability!!! Grease/oil makes metal to metal contact as frictionless as possible, but you NEED the metal to metal contact friction to stop your car. You want the ability to stop your car, right? Grease on the back of the pad as shown in video is good as it reduces oscillation and brake squeaking, but only a thin layer is needed as it can drip onto rotor if used in excess- you can use copper grease for this part instead of what the chap used in the video
